uniapp ios
时间: 2025-01-25 09:21:30 浏览: 50
### UniApp iOS 开发教程
#### 项目初始化与环境搭建
为了启动一个新的 UniApp 项目并针对 iOS 平台进行开发,开发者需先安装 HBuilderX 或其他支持的 IDE,并确保已设置好 Node.js 和 npm 环境。创建新项目时可以选择模板来加速初期构建过程[^1]。
```bash
npm install -g @vue/cli
vue create my-project-name
cd my-project-name
```
对于希望直接利用官方提供的工具链来进行操作的情况,则可以直接通过 HBuilderX 创建工程而无需额外命令行指令。
#### 打包前准备工作
在准备向 Apple App Store 发布之前,必须完成一系列必要的前期工作:
- 注册成为苹果开发者计划成员;
- 获取用于签名的应用程序 ID、推送通知 SSL 证书以及分发用的 Provisioning Profile 文件;
- 准备应用图标集和其他视觉资源文件;
上述步骤通常涉及访问 [Apple Developer](https://developer.apple.com/) 官方网站以获取相应权限和服务[^2]。
#### 使用云打包服务
当选择了较为简便的方式——即云端自动化处理时,只需按照提示填写必要参数(如 Bundle Identifier, Team ID 等),之后提交任务等待服务器返回 IPA 文件即可。这种方式适合于那些不熟悉 Xcode 操作或是想要节省时间的小型团队和个人开发者[^3]。
然而需要注意的是,由于网络状况或其他因素的影响,可能会遇到排队等候较长时间的问题,因此建议提前规划发布时间表[^4]。
#### 进行本地离线打包
如果倾向于更灵活地控制整个编译流程,那么可以考虑采用本地化的方法。这要求计算机上已经正确设置了 macOS 及其附带的 Xcode 工具套件作为基础运行环境。接着依照文档指引逐步执行如下动作:
- 导入私钥和公钥对至 Keychain Access 中;
- 下载并导入由苹果颁发的相关证书;
- 设置正确的 Build Settings 参数值;
最后一步是在终端内调用 `cordova build ios` 或者借助图形界面下的菜单选项触发实际的构建行为。
#### 处理常见错误信息
在整个过程中难免会碰到各式各样的挑战,比如因配置不当而导致无法正常生成二进制文件等问题。此时应该仔细阅读日志输出寻找线索,同时参考社区论坛分享的经验贴寻求灵感。一些典型的修复措施可能包括但不限于更新依赖库版本号、调整 Info.plist 内容项等具体改动。
阅读全文
相关推荐


















